About Apxenta Tablet

Apxenta Tablet is used to treat Plaque psoriasis (scaly, itchy, and red patches on the skin), psoriasis arthritis (inflammation in the joints in people with psoriasis), and oral ulcers. Psoriasis is a chronic, painful, nontransmissible, deactivating and damaging disease. It can happen at any age and is most common in the age group 50 to 69. Psoriatic arthritis is a type of arthritis that some people with psoriasis experience.

Apxenta Tablet contains Apremilast, a phosphodiesterase 4 (PDE4) inhibitor. Apxenta Tablet works by blocking the action of some chemical messengers that are responsible for inflammation related to psoriatic arthritis (inflammation in the joints in people with psoriasis) and psoriasis (scaly, itchy, and red patches on the skin) and, thus, lower the signs and symptoms of these conditions.

Take Apxenta Tablet as prescribed by your doctor. You are advised to take Apxenta Tablet for as long as your doctor has prescribed it for you, depending on your medical conditions. You may experience diarrhoea, vomiting, nausea, weight loss, and back pain. Most of these side effects of Apxenta Tablet do not require medical attention and gradually resolve over time. However, if the side effects are persistent, reach out to your doctor.

Apxenta Tablet should not be taken in conditions like depression as it is getting worse with thoughts of suicide. Before starting Apxenta Tablet , please inform your doctor if you have any allergy to Apxenta Tablet and its parts. Apxenta Tablet not recommended for use in children and adolescents aged below 17 years. If you are pregnant or breastfeeding, ask your doctor for advice before taking this Apxenta Tablet . Apxenta Tablet does not affect the ability to drive and use machines.

Uses of Apxenta Tablet

Treatment of Plaque psoriasis, psoriasis arthritis, and oral ulcers caused by Behcet's disease.

Directions for Use

Take Apxenta Tablet as prescribed by your doctor. Your doctor determines the dose of the medicine based on your condition. Take Apxenta Tablet with or without food. Swallow the Apxenta Tablet as a whole with a glass of water. Do not crush, chew, or break it.

Medicinal Benefits

Apxenta Tablet is used in treating psoriatic arthritis; it decreases pain and swelling and may help improve flexibility in the affected joints. It is also used to treat moderate to severe plaque psoriasis (skin disease causes red, scaly patches to form on some areas of the body) in people who may benefit from medications). It is used to treat ulcers in the mouth in persons with Behcet's syndrome (a disease that results from blood vessel swelling in the body). Apxenta Tablet works by blocking the action of some chemical messengers responsible for inflammation related to psoriatic arthritis and psoriasis, thus lowering the signs and symptoms of these conditions.

How Apxenta Tablet Works

Apxenta Tablet contains Apremilast, a phosphodiesterase 4 (PDE4) inhibitor. Apxenta Tablet works by blocking the action of some chemical messengers that are responsible for inflammation related to psoriatic arthritis (inflammation in the joints in people with psoriasis) and psoriasis (scaly, itchy, and red patches on the skin) and, thus, lower the signs and symptoms of these conditions.

Drug Warnings

Inform your doctor before using Apxenta Tablet , if you have previously had an allergic reaction (hypersensitivity). Before starting Apxenta Tablet , please inform your doctor if you have depression and suicidal thoughts. Inform your doctor before taking Apxenta Tablet if you have severe kidney problems. Inform your doctor while taking Apxenta Tablet if you lose weight without meaning to. Apxenta Tablet should not be taken in conditions like severe diarrhoea, nausea, and vomiting. Apxenta Tablet not recommended for use in children and adolescents aged below 17 years. If you are pregnant or breastfeeding, ask your doctor for advice before taking this Apxenta Tablet . Patients with rare hereditary galactose intolerance problems, total lactase deficiency or glucose-galactose malabsorption should not take Apxenta Tablet .

ApremilastMitotane
Severe
How does the drug interact with Apxenta Tablet 10's:
Coadministration of Mitotane with Apxenta Tablet 10's may reduce the effectiveness of treatment.

How to manage the interaction:
Although taking Apxenta Tablet 10's and Mitotane together can cause an interaction, it can be taken if a doctor has suggested it. Do not discontinue any medications without consulting a doctor.
ApremilastCarbamazepine
Severe
How does the drug interact with Apxenta Tablet 10's:
Taking Apxenta Tablet 10's with carbamazepine can significantly reduce the blood levels of Apxenta Tablet 10's, which may make the medication less effective.

How to manage the interaction:
Taking Apxenta Tablet 10's with Carbamazepine together can result in an interaction, but it can be taken if a doctor has advised it. However, if you experience any unusual symptoms contact a doctor immediately. Do not stop using any medications without talking to a doctor.

Diet & Lifestyle Advise

  • Physical activity helps strengthen muscles and relieves joint stiffness. Gentle activities like 20-30minutes of walking or swimming would be helpful.
  • Performing yoga may also help in improving joint flexibility and pain management.
  • Maintain a healthy weight by performing regular low-strain exercises and eating healthy food.
  • Get adequate sleep, as resting the muscles can help in reducing inflammation and swelling.
  • Follow heat or cold therapy, and apply a cold or hot compress on the joints for 15-20minutes regularly.
  • De-stress yourself by meditating, reading books, taking a warm bubble bath or listening to soothing music.
  • Acupuncture, massage and physical therapy may also be helpful.
  • Eat food rich in antioxidants such as berries, spinach, kidney beans, dark chocolate, etc.
  • Foods containing flavonoids help in reducing inflammation. These include soy, berries, broccoli, grapes and green tea.
  • Avoid smoking and alcohol consumption.

FAQs

Apxenta Tablet is used to treat plaque psoriasis (scaly, itchy, and red patches on the skin), psoriatic arthritis (inflammation in the joints in people with psoriasis), and oral ulcers caused by Behcet's disease.
Apxenta Tablet works by blocking the action of some chemical messengers that are responsible for inflammation.
Yes, Apxenta Tablet may cause depression as a side effect. The patient may also have suicidal thoughts. Apxenta Tablet should be avoided in people with a history of depression. In case you develop any of these symptoms, Inform your doctor immediately.
Apxenta Tablet is used to treat plaque psoriasis (red, scaly, thick, itchy, painful patches on the skin) and psoriatic arthritis (a condition that causes joint pain and swelling). It is a long-period treatment and may take about 16 weeks to show an improvement.
Yes, Apxenta Tablet may cause a reduction in appetite, which may further lead to weight loss. You should monitor your weight frequently while on treatment with Apxenta Tablet . In case of big weight loss, inform your doctor. Your doctor may consider stopping Apxenta Tablet .
Rifampicin is an antibiotic. You should not take rifampicin if you are taking Apxenta Tablet . Rifampicin interferes with the working of Apxenta Tablet by reducing its levels, making it less effective. As a result, you may not see any recovery after taking Apxenta Tablet .
As soon as you recall, take the missed dose. If the next dose is approaching, skip the missing dose and resume your regular dosing regimen. Do not duplicate the dose to make up for a missing one.
No, Apxenta Tablet is not an immunosuppressant. It belongs to a class of drugs called phosphodiesterase 4 (PDE4) inhibitors which work by blocking the action of PDE4 that is found in inflammatory cells.
Take Apxenta Tablet as advised by the doctor. Swallow it as whole with a glass of water. Do not break, crush or chew it.
If you get pregnant during treatment with Apxenta Tablet , inform your doctor immediately. You are recommended to avoid pregnancy during treatment with Apxenta Tablet as it may harm unborn baby.
Apxenta Tablet may cause side effects such as nausea, vomiting, diarrhoea, back pain or weight loss. If these side effects persist or worsen, please consult your doctor.
